ROBERT L. BRUNSCHEEN
Clarence
Robert L. Brunscheen, age 68, passed away at Unity Point St. Luke's in Cedar Rapids on Jan. 7, 2018. Memorial services will be held at Trinity Lutheran Church in Lowden on Thursday, Jan. 11, 2018, at 10:30 a.m. with Rev. Daniel Redhage officiating. Visitation also will be at Trinity on Wednesday, Jan. 10, from 4 to 7 p.m. Private family burial will be in the Clarence Cemetery.
Robert was born on Sept. 4, 1949, to Alvin and Bernice Schrader Brunscheen in Anamosa, Iowa. He married Sandra Norton on Nov. 25, 1967, also in Anamosa.
Survivors include his mother, Bernice of Mechanicsville; wife, Sandra; sons, Jeff (Karen) of Ely, Dain (Missy) of Cedar Rapids and Diek (Morgan) of Marion; grandchildren, Zach, Daniel, Jordyn and Emily Brunscheen, Andrew (Nicole), Dillon (Haley) and Drake Brunscheen, and Tyler Carmer, Kelsey Carmer, Dexter and Brady Brunscheen; great-grandsons, Jaxton and Colton; brothers, Bill (Cheryl) of Solon and Scott (Karen) of Des Moines; and sisters, Cheryl (Larry) Herren of Polk City, Iowa, and Connie (Jon) Buss of Ames.
Robert was a truck driver (transportation engineer) all his life, and was recognized in May of 2017 for 50 years in the trucking industry. His faith and family were important to him, as was his saying for people to be kind to one another.
He was preceded in death by his father; and sister, Sandra Roseberry.
The family would like to thank the hospice staff at St. Luke's for the outstanding care given to Robert.
Chapman Funeral Home, Clarence is assisting the family.
